WebMar 22, 2024 · Anytime you have code in a base Microsoft form DataSource field, you can use Chain Of Command to add additional code before or after the call to the base method. You still always have to call the base method. But you can change how the method works. WebOct 26, 2024 · These methods are a subset of the methods in the FormDataSource system class. You use the AOT to access the standard methods: Expand the node for the form data source on the form. Right-click the Methods node. Select Override Method. Note. Code written on forms cannot be re-used or inherited. WebFeb 7, 2024 · Always use x++ compile time functions such as formdatasourcestr () to ensure compile time checking for accessing formrun and formdatasource objects correctly.
